Artificial joint implant
Abstract:
An artificial joint implant (1) comprising a first element (2) with a socket (4) and a second element (3) with a ball head (5), wherein said ball head (5) is insertable in said socket (4) such as to form a ball-and-socket connection between said first element (2) and said second element (3), and the movement of said ball head (5) in said socket (4) is restricted by means of a protrusion (6.1; 6.2) engaged in a groove (7), whereby said protrusion (6.1; 6.2) has a central axis A2 and is protruding from the surface of said socket (4) and said groove (7) is provided on the surface of said ball head (5) or vice versa; —said groove (7) is positioned along a great circle of said ball head (5) or of said socket (4), —said protrusion (6.1; 6.2) has a shape allowing rotation of the protrusion around its central axis A2 when received in the groove (7); and—the surface roughness of the protrusion (6.1; 6.2) and/or of the groove (7) is at most 25 micrometers.
